Specialty butcher shops are in
July 16, 2018
Meat consumption is on the rise in the U.S. with the average American eating 222 pounds of red meat and poultry, up 20 pounds over the past four years. While 10 percent of butcher shops have closed since 2010, many of those that have continued have not only survived, but thrived as consumers look for more personalized service and products.
